**Job Description & Responsibilities:**
Ready to be the star of our front desk? Under general supervision, you'll master all the ins and outs of patient registration while keeping things running smoothly and efficiently. Here's where you'll shine:
- **Welcome with Warmth:** Be the friendly face and voice that sets the tone for every patient interaction—whether it's face-to-face check-ins, phone calls, or preregistration. You're basically the welcoming front door that makes people feel valued from day one!
- **Registration & Insurance Champion:** Navigate patient registration like a pro, keeping records up-to-date and accurate. Confirm insurance eligibility, verify coverage details, and handle cash collections with confidence and care.
- **Customer Service Superstar:** Respond to inquiries from callers and customers with enthusiasm and expertise. Advocate passionately on their behalf to ensure their needs are met and they leave feeling heard and supported.
- **Build Loyalty & Anticipate Needs:** Go the extra mile by anticipating what patients need before they ask. Your proactive approach and genuine care will instill loyalty and create positive experiences that keep people coming back.
- **Thrive in the Fast Lane:** Juggle multiple tasks in a dynamic, fast-paced environment with frequent interruptions—and make it look easy! Your ability to stay organized and flexible is key to keeping everything on track.
- **Share Your Knowledge:** Be willing and able to mentor and instruct others, helping your team succeed and grow together.
Qualifications
E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:
- High school diploma or G.E.D. equivalent required.
- One (1) year of experience related to patient admitting, registration and/or insurance eligibility and verification in a hospital or medical office setting preferred.
- EPIC training/experience preferred. Insurance payor systems experience preferred.
- ICD-10 medical terminology experience preferred.
- Strong computer skills and working knowledge of Microsoft Office products.
- Ability to meet or exceed core customer service responsibilities, standards, and behaviors effectively over the telephone, in person and in writing with patients, visitors and clinical/non-clinical staff.
- Must be willing and able to instruct others. Ability to perform a variety of tasks in a fast-paced environment with frequent interruptions.
